Part 7011.0870 - STAGE-ONE VAPOR RECOVERY

Universal Citation: MN Rules 7011.0870

Current through Register Vol. 48, No. 39, March 25, 2024

Subpart 1. Applicability.

The owner or operator of a gasoline service station required to install and operate a stage-one vapor recovery system shall comply with this part.

Subp. 2. System design.

Stage-one vapor recovery systems must:

A. conform with the requirements of Design Criteria for Stage I Vapor Control Systems - Gasoline Service Stations as incorporated by reference in part 7011.0865;

B. incorporate a submerged fill pipe in each storage tank; and

C. have a vent system that is equipped with a pressure vacuum valve that complies with Vapor Recovery Certification Procedure CP-201, as incorporated by reference in part 7011.0865.

Subp. 3. System operation and maintenance.

A. The owner or operator of a gasoline service station with a vapor recovery system shall not accept gasoline without the vapor recovery system properly connected.

B. The owner or operator of a gasoline service station with stage-one vapor recovery shall:
(1) maintain and operate the vapor recovery system in accordance with manufacturer's specifications;

(2) promptly repair any malfunction of the system;

(3) keep on the premises a copy of the manufacturer's operation and maintenance instructions and make these instructions available to the commissioner or an authorized representative of the commissioner on request; and

(4) maintain system monitoring or testing devices in proper working order.
